China overhead line fittings, crafted from iron or aluminum, secure and support conductors in power lines. Various hardware types include clamps for wire installation, hanging rings for insulator strings, crimping and repair tubes for wire connections, and spacer bars for split wires. In addition, cable fittings for pole towers are utilized. These components not only fix and support wires but also assemble suspension insulators into strings, connecting and hanging them on tower cross arms. Design and manufacturing considerations prioritize strength, stiffness, and wear resistance for long-term use. Selection and configuration of hardware must align with specific line conditions to ensure the safe and stable operation of overhead lines. The components of an overhead line, a crucial element in power transmission and distribution, consist of a well-coordinated system of essential elements designed to efficiently transport electrical energy from generation sources to end-users. At its core, an overhead line typically comprises conductors, supporting structures, insulators, and associated hardware. Conductors form the backbone of the overhead line, serving as the pathway for electricity to flow. These conductors are often made of aluminum or copper, chosen for their excellent conductivity and durability. Supporting structures, such as poles or towers, play a critical role in elevating the conductors above the ground and maintaining the required clearance. The design and placement of these structures are essential to ensure the stability and reliability of the overhead line. Insulators, often made of ceramic or composite materials, are strategically placed to electrically isolate the conductors from the supporting structures, preventing unintended paths for current flow. This is crucial for maintaining the integrity and safety of the system. Additionally, associated hardware such as clamps, connectors, and fittings are employed to secure and connect various components of the overhead line, ensuring a robust and reliable transmission network.

The Air Dyer is specially designed to remove the water vapor from the air to protect sensitive tools and machinery. To dry the air from the air compressor an Aftercooler and Dryer are utilized. The aftercooler is a heat exchanger for cooling the discharge air from the air compressor. The water vapor from the compressed air is condensed into liquid form and pushed into the Air Dyer.
